Hi, I'm Susan Jabinski, co-host of the Morning Filter podcast. On a recent episode, Morningstar Chief US Market Strategist Dave Sekera talked about a handful of stocks that he liked today as what he called stocks to rent. These stocks aren't great long-term holdings or forever stocks. They're mostly no moat stocks with high degrees of uncertainty around their cash flows, but they are good stocks to rent because they're trading at really attractive prices and have interesting shorter-term theses supporting them. His picks were Lennar, RH, Ford, Malibu Boats, and Celanese. Today, we're taking a look at two more stocks to rent that look deeply undervalued today. Our first deeply undervalued stock to rent is Mosaic. Mosaic is a leading producer of potash and phosphate fertilizers. It's a cyclical commodity business that's coming down from an unusually strong period. Fertilizer prices have fallen sharply, pressuring revenue, earnings, and margins. Mosaic has also faced challenges in its phosphate business, including competition, higher costs, and weaker pricing. However, higher phosphate prices should drive sequential unit profits in the third quarter and lead to continued improvement in profits through the rest of 2026 and into 2027. In potash, we forecast that global demand growth in 2026 will keep the market largely in balance. We assign Mosaic stock a $35 fair value estimate. Our second cheap stock to rent is Winnebago. The company manufactures motor homes along with towables, customized specialty vehicles, boats, and parts. RV demand soared during the pandemic, pulling forward future demand. The company has spent the past few years trying to right-size production and dealer inventories. We expect dealers to remain cautious on ordering inventory into at least early fiscal 2027, but industry data shows that 8.1 million US households owned an RV in 2025 with another 16.9 million intending to buy one within 5 years. Although we don't think Winnebago has carved out an economic moat, we do think the company has enough brand equity to give it a good shot at capitalizing on these growth trends. We think Winnebago stock is worth $73 per share and it trades well below that fair value.
